How they compare

British Virgin Islands currently reports 0.978 GPIA against 0.9767 GPIA in MDG: Sub-saharan Africa, a difference of 0.0013 GPIA.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 24 shared years of data; in 1999 it was British Virgin Islands ahead.

British Virgin Islands ranks 156th and MDG: Sub-saharan Africa ranks 155th of 199 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, British Virgin Islands averaged higher in 3 and MDG: Sub-saharan Africa in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ade British Virgin Islands MDG: Sub-saharan Africa Difference Ahead
1990s 0.9181 GPIA 0.8424 GPIA 0.0757 GPIA British Virgin Islands
2000s 0.9752 GPIA 0.8643 GPIA 0.1108 GPIA British Virgin Islands
2010s 0.9451 GPIA 0.9353 GPIA 0.0099 GPIA British Virgin Islands
2020s 0.96 GPIA 0.9691 GPIA 0.0091 GPIA MDG: Sub-saharan Africa

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
